Word: Copestone

Part of Speech: Noun

Simple Definition: A copestone is a special stone that is placed on the very top of a wall or building. It can also mean something that is the final touch or the most important achievement in a series of accomplishments.

Usage Instructions:
  • Use "copestone" when talking about architecture or construction to refer to the top stone of a structure.
  • You can also use it metaphorically to describe the final achievement in a project or life goal.
Examples:
  1. Architectural Usage: "The builders carefully placed the copestone on the top of the wall to make it strong and beautiful."
  2. Metaphorical Usage: "Winning the championship was the copestone of her athletic career, bringing all her hard work to a successful end."
Advanced Usage:

In advanced contexts, "copestone" can be used to discuss not only physical structures but also in literary or artistic discussions, where it might refer to the final element that completes a work of art or literature.

Word Variants:
  • Coping Stone: Another term often used interchangeably with "copestone," particularly in British English.
  • Culmination: A synonym that refers to the highest point or climax of something.
Different Meanings:
  • Literal Meaning: The stone that caps the top of a wall.
  • Figurative Meaning: The final achievement or the most important accomplishment.
Synonyms:
  • Capstone
  • Topstone
  • Finishing touch
  • Crowning achievement

Noun
  1. a stone that forms the top of wall or building
  2. a final touch; a crowning achievement; a culmination
